Vin # 9F03F194042 65 Cobra Replica

Midnight Blue (proper Ford Dupont F8249)

I have a complete binder with every detail of the paperwork on the build for this car – Build began in 2001 and completed in 2002 built on an ERA Square Tube frame/body

· Southern Automotive installed a real 427 Side Oiler motor that is a Blueprinted engine putting out 515HP and it even has Ported and Polished Aluminum heads and chrome Cobra Intake – yes I have the paperwork (Block has no welding and is not bored oversize)

o Steel Crank, Reed Solid Cam, Lemans Rods, Ford Powertrain Forged Pistons, High volume oil pump, Canton race oil pan and pickup, Billet Distributor, 90amp Alternator, Chrome Headers/side pipes – Firewall is also polished stainless

· Properly built Top loader 4speed with NASCAR Racing hardware (Muncie Rock crusher gearing)

o Tilton Hydraulic Clutch and polished chrome scatter shield

· Ford 9 inch Posi Traction Rear end

Top Quality Instrumentation setup, Rack and pinion steering and 4 Wheel Disc Brake setup, balanced driveline,

· Steel framed Hi Grade Leather Seats by California Custom, Moto-Lita MK3 Classic Wood Rim Steering wheel, Top quality 4 core Griffin Radiator with dual fan setup

· MSD 6al Electronic Ignition and High Torque starter

· Wilton Wool Carpets
